10:05 — Folks started pinging that Shrinkwright, our batch image-resize CLI, was silently skipping anything over 40MB. Turned out the new streaming flag defaulted off in the release build. Patched, re-ran the affected batches, all good by 11:30. Full details in the doc; the offending build is tagged with the token below.

session token of tajef-bageg = htk21_5d90d574934f3ccae6437

Ticket: Catalogue import drift on Shelfwright

For new team members: the nightly catalogue import for the Marlow branch library has been failing record validation since Tuesday. Root cause is configuration drift — the staging importer was updated to the v3 field mappings, but production still runs a hand-edited config from an old incident. This is a known risk with Shelfwright deploys; configs are not yet managed declaratively. To diagnose, first compare the intended settings against what production is actually running, shown below.

deployment values, hahaf-fahop:
zorwyn:
  log_level: debug
  metrics_host: metrics.zorwyn.tolvaqlabs.internal
  pool_size: 8

Subject: Partner SFTP drop — new owner

Hi,

As you review the pending changes to the Harborline ingest scripts, note that ownership of the partner SFTP drop is changing at the end of the month. This includes key rotation, the nightly pull job, and the quarantine folder for malformed files. Review comments on the retry logic should still go through the normal PR flow, but questions about drop-folder conventions or partner onboarding now go to the new owner. The incoming owner is listed below.

signatory, tagaf-bahaf: Praael Fenmir Rusok

Pilot with Tindersholt Retail — Manager Brief (restricted)

Heads up, team: the Tindersholt pilot goes live in six stores across the Avenmoor region next month. We're stocking the Brixley range only, with weekly sell-through reporting back to Petra's group. Keep this off general channels until the joint announcement. Where this fits in our roadmap is spelled out in the confidential note below.

internal memo for kaguf-yajog: Headcount on the Druath team goes from 30 to 70 by the end of November. Gross margin on Druath came in at 56 percent against a plan of 28 percent.